Gutter reattachment services involve securing and reinstalling gutters that have become loose, detached, or misaligned on a property. Over time, weather conditions, age, or improper installation can cause gutters to shift or pull away from the fascia. When gutters are no longer properly attached, they may not effectively channel rainwater away from the home’s foundation, leading to potential water damage or erosion. Service providers assess the current condition of the gutters, identify the cause of detachment, and securely reattach or realign the gutters to ensure they function as intended.
This service helps address common problems such as overflowing gutters, water pooling around the foundation, and damage to fascia boards or siding caused by improper drainage. Detached or loose gutters can also lead to increased wear and tear, resulting in the need for more extensive repairs if not addressed promptly. Gutter reattachment is a practical solution to restore proper water flow, prevent structural issues, and maintain the overall integrity of the property’s exterior. It is especially valuable after storms or severe weather events that may have loosened or shifted the gutters.

The overview below groups typical Gutter Reattachment proj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Spring Hill, FL.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typically, gutter reattachment for minor sections or fixing loose brackets ranges from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the length and accessibility of the gutter system. Fewer projects escalate into higher costs unless additional repairs are needed.
Moderate Fixes - For more extensive reattachment work involving multiple sections or replacing damaged hangers, costs generally range from $600-$1,200. Local contractors often see many jobs in this tier, especially in homes with aging gutter systems requiring multiple adjustments.
Large-Scale Repairs - When reattaching large sections or addressing extensive damage, prices can range from $1,200-$2,500. Larger, more complex projects are less common but can occur in homes with significant gutter issues or difficult access points.
Full Reattachment Projects - Complete reattachment or replacement of entire gutter runs can cost $2,500-$5,000+ depending on the size and complexity of the property. These larger projects are less frequent and typically involve extensive work or custom solutions by local service providers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es gutters to become detached? Gutters can become detached due to weather damage, age, improper installation, or debris buildup that adds stress to the system.
How do professionals reattach loose gutters? Service providers typically secure the gutters using appropriate fasteners, ensuring they are properly aligned and sealed for stability.
Is gutter reattachment suitable for all types of gutter materials? Most gutter types, including aluminum, vinyl, and steel, can be reattached by experienced contractors, though specific methods may vary.
Can gutter reattachment prevent future detachment issues? Proper reattachment by skilled contractors can help improve gutter stability and reduce the likelihood of future detachment.
What are signs that gutters need reattachment? Visible sagging, misalignment, or gutters pulling away from the house are common indicators that reattachment services may be needed.
